前言
前端开发是目前最热门的技术之一,每天也有许多优秀的库和框架被加入生态圈。ozylog-boilerplate 也是其中的一员,它是一个用来创建 Web 项目的构建工具,帮助开发者省去了很多繁琐的配置工作。ozylog-boilerplate 提供了各种用于构建现代化 Web 应用程序的特性,包括 linting,testing,代码压缩等,可以让开发者更加高效地进行前端开发。
安装
使用 ozylog-boilerplate 之前需要先安装 Node.js 和 npm。安装好之后,就可以在命令行中使用 npm 安装 ozylog-boilerplate:
npm install -g ozylog-boilerplate
这里使用了 -g
参数来全局安装 ozylog-boilerplate。如果不使用 -g
,则需要在项目的根目录中安装 ozylog-boilerplate,这样每个项目都需要单独安装。全局安装可以让你在任何项目中都能使用该工具。
使用
使用 ozylog-boilerplate 创建一个新的项目非常简单,只需要在命令行中执行以下命令:
ozylog-boilerplate init myproject
这里的 myproject
是项目名称,你可以根据自己的需要来命名。
初始化命令将在你当前的工作目录中创建一个新的项目目录,其中包含了代码的基本目录架构和一些示例文件。该命令还会提示你输入一些基本信息,例如项目名称、作者、描述等。
完成初始化之后,你可以使用以下命令来构建和运行项目:
npm run build # 构建项目 npm run serve # 运行项目
构建命令将生成优化后的代码,包括压缩和混淆文件。运行命令将启动本地服务器并在浏览器中打开项目页面。
模板
ozylog-boilerplate 提供了多种模板来帮助你快速创建各种类型的项目。可以使用以下命令查看可用的模板:
ozylog-boilerplate list
该命令将列出所有可用的模板,包括模板名称、模板描述以及模板的 URL。你可以使用以下命令来创建一个新的项目,其中 template-name
是你所选择的模板名称:
ozylog-boilerplate init myproject --template-name=template-name
可以在初始化命令中使用 --template-name
参数来选择使用哪个模板。例如,要使用名为 react
的模板来创建一个新的项目,可以执行以下命令:
ozylog-boilerplate init myproject --template-name=react
自定义配置
ozylog-boilerplate 还允许你自定义配置文件,以满足你的特定需求。默认情况下,ozylog-boilerplate 会使用预定义的配置文件,其中包括一些常用的配置选项。如果你需要添加或修改某些配置选项,则可以创建一个名为 ozylog.config.js
的文件,并放置在你的项目根目录下。
以下是一个示例 ozylog.config.js
文件,其中设置了对 JSX 语法的支持:
module.exports = { babel: { presets: ['@babel/preset-react'] } };
要使这个配置文件生效,需要在 package.json
文件中添加以下内容:
{ "ozylog": { "configPath": "./ozylog.config.js" } }
这样 ozylog-boilerplate 将会加载你的自定义配置文件来覆盖默认配置。
总结
ozylog-boilerplate 是一个优秀的工具,它可以帮助开发者更加高效地进行前端开发。本文介绍了如何安装和使用 ozylog-boilerplate,包括如何使用模板和自定义配置。希望本文能够帮助读者快速了解 ozylog-boilerplate 的使用方法,从而更加轻松地进行前端开发。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005579081e8991b448d48e8